Handover — Queuescale autoscaler (Dorn → Imri)

Queuescale polls the Harbrook job queue and scales worker pods on depth thresholds. Scaling decisions are signed and audited; the signing key rotates monthly via the Veldt vault. Security-relevant caveat: the scale-down path skips the audit hook under 2 pods — fix pending. The values currently governing thresholds and audit behavior are as follows.

config for tagep-yajef:
ulawyn:
  log_level: error
  metrics_host: metrics.ulawyn.lumiclabs.internal
  pin: 0564
  pool_size: 32

14:22 — On-call engineer at Norvane confirmed that resolution failures for the internal `queue.svc` name occurred only on nodes in the Bramleigh zone, roughly one request in forty. Packet captures showed the stub resolver racing two upstreams and occasionally accepting a stale NXDOMAIN from the decommissioned secondary. We pinned resolvers to the primary pair and redeployed the affected pods. The correlating trace token from the capture session is recorded below.

pipeline stamp: htk9_ce63042d9

Welcome to the SpokeShift plugin program. SpokeShift rebalances dock inventory across the fictional Verren Bay bike network, and plugins can contribute custom demand-forecast models. Your plugin runs in a sandboxed worker and receives dock snapshots every five minutes; return a list of move suggestions and the dispatcher handles the rest. Rate limits and scoring rules are documented in the plugin handbook. For local development, point your plugin harness at the shared sandbox database using the connection string below.

replica DSN, kajep-yahag: mssql://praok_svc:iF@db-8d68.plorvaio.local:5432/eliion

## Runbook: Quillbase ORM Migration, Phase 2

We are replacing the legacy Hexley ORM layer with repository classes. During the transition, both code paths run against the same replica, so the reviewer should confirm query logging is disabled on the old path to avoid leaking row data. The new repository layer authenticates to the replica via an env-provided credential. Before starting the migration worker, set this line in its env file:

secret setting of bawig-tahog: LEDGER_TOKEN29=7ae6e37c9e201811f2d139633512f